Job Description

KEY Roles and Responsibilities

·       With guidance from the Immunization Strengthening Project Manager, support the implementation of the project demand creation activities in the location

·       Closely work with key RHB and other key stakeholders to develop and implement locally relevant and feasible SBCC strategies for immunization service

·       Support the design and implementation of SBCC related assessments in the project areas

·       Contribute to the development and review of SBCC messages / materials in collaboration with other program staff, relevant Governmental offices, Partners and community representatives.

·       Support development and review of relevant training materials and job aids.

·       Organize and execute community SBCC campaigns in collaboration with other stakeholders.

·       Support the design of appropriate monitoring and evaluation tools for SBCC activities in collaboration with other stakeholders, Project Manager, M&E Officer and technical advisor

·       Support assessments of gender related barriers on immunization service uptake in the implementation areas

·       Support the evaluation/documentation of the impact of SBCC activities in collaboration with other stakeholders

·       Participate in all Save the Children initiated as well as multi-stakeholders’ advocacy activities, forums and networks aimed at raising the profile of immunization issues as assigned

·       Undertake regular documentation of activities including lessons learned and success stories.

·       Document lessons learned, and write case stories in immunization related community mobilization activities and report on a regular basis

·       Prepare and submit regular updates and reports to Immunization Strengthening Project Manager as per agreed frequency and formats

·       Conduct regular field visits to undertake, support, monitor and document BCC activities in the implementation areas

·       Participate in joint field visits, review meetings and planning meetings.

 Job Requirements

Q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E

  • Degree in the field of Public Health, Nursing, Health Education, or related health fields
  • 4-5 years relevant experience with at least three years in an INGO environment implementing SBCC activities and preferably in the immunization program
  • Computer literacy in all the Microsoft Office applications, and internet literacy are required
  • Experience in research, including qualitative methodologies is required
  • Experience in working with multicultural team and complex projects
  • Good understanding of the Health Extension Program is a plus,
  • Good communication skills
  • Fluency in English, writing and speaking
  • Ability to work in team, strong negotiation and analytical skills; ability to multitask and work under pressure and tight deadlines.
  • Willingness to extensively travel to project implementation woredas
  • Understanding of the local culture
  • Commitment to Save the Children values
